【python中判断多个元素是否在列表中】教程文章相关的互联网学习教程文章

python字典添加元素和删除元素【代码】

1. 添加字典元素 方法一:直接添加,给定键值对#pycharm aa = {人才:60,英语:english,adress:here} print(aa) # {人才: 60, 英语: english, adress: here} #添加方法一:根据键值对添加 aa[价格] = 100 print(aa) # {人才: 60, 英语: english, adress: here, 价格: 100}方法二:使用update方法#添加方法二:使用update方法添加 xx = {hhh:gogogo} aa.update(xx) print(aa) # {人才: 60, 英语: english, adress: here, 价格: 100, h...

python-使用numpy.lib.stride_tricks.as_strided滑动NaN填充元素的窗口【代码】

考虑数组import numpy as np import pandas as pdnp.random.seed([3,1415]) a = np.random.randint(100, size=10) print(a)[11 98 74 90 15 55 13 11 13 26]我正在使用从numpy.lib.stride_tricks导入的as_strided 当我使用它给滚动窗口如下时as_strided(a, shape=(len(a), 5), strides=(8, -8))[[11 0 0 0 0][98 11 0 0 0][74 98 11 0 0][90 74 98 11 0][15 90 74 98 11][55 15 90 74 98][13 55 15 90 74][11 13 55 15 9...

python-给定一个包含许多元素的列表,我如何获得完美三元组的数量?【代码】

我正在尝试解决一个给定整数列表的编程问题,请找到完美三元组[x,y,z]的数量,其中y%x == 0和z%y == 0 例如,[1、2、3、4、5、6]具有三元组:[1、2、4],[1、2、6],[1、3、6],使答案3总计. 这是我到目前为止的内容:def solution(l):l.sort()l.reverse()l_size = len(l)count = 0if len(l) < 3:return countfor i in xrange(len(l) - 2):for j in xrange(i + 1, len(l) - 1):if l[i] % l[j] == 0:for k in xrange(j + 1, len(l)):if ...

将上一个元素添加到列表中的当前元素,然后分配给变量-Python 3.5.2【代码】

关于此的第一篇文章,我很激动!好的,这是一个问题:如何将上一个元素添加到当前元素,然后从这些值中创建一个新列表,以将其添加到matplotlib图中?这是我的代码示例:example_list = [20, 5, 5, -10]print(example_list) '''first output should be''' [20, 5, 5, -10]value1 = (example_list[0]) value2 = (example_list[0] + example_list[1]) value3 = (example_list[0] + example_list[1] + example_list[2]) value4 = (example...

python-将元素添加到数组的可能性【代码】

因此,我在Python中建立了一个列表,例如,让我们说前100个整数,但是我确实需要所有100个整数,但只有一个样本可以说3.import random def f():list_ = []for i in range(100):list_.append(i)return list_def g(list_,k):return random.sample(list_, k)print(g(f(),3))>>>[50, 92, 6]现在我可以避免不首先构建整个列表,而是直接构建示例,也许是通过增加将元素添加到f()中的列表的概率来进行构建 因为如果我要建立一个庞大的列表,该列表...

Python RegEx匹配每个方括号元素【代码】

我一直在为以下字符串想出一个正则表达式:[1,null,"7. Mai 2017"],[2,"test","8. Mai 2018"],[3,"test","9. Mai 2019"]我正在尝试将每个括号及其内容作为单个内容作为匹配输出输出,如下所示:[1,null,"7. Mai 2017"] [2,"test","8. Mai 2018"] [3,"test","9. Mai 2019"]我最初的天真方法是这样的:(\[[^d],.+\])+但是,那 .规则太笼统,最终会与整行匹配.有什么提示吗?解决方法:我不确定要尝试解析的数据格式以及它来自何处,但看起...

python-沿着aixs查找张量中非零元素的数量【代码】

我想找到沿特定轴的张量中非零元素的数量.有没有可以执行此操作的PyTorch函数? 我试图在PyTorch中使用nonzero()方法.torch.nonzero(losses).size(0)在这里,损失是一个形状为64 x 1的张量.当我运行上面的语句时,它给了我以下错误.TypeError: Type Variable doesn't implement stateless method nonzero但是如果我运行torch.nonzero(losses.data).size(0),那么它可以正常工作.有任何线索,为什么会这样或错误意味着什么?解决方法:错...

python-复制熊猫列表中的元素【代码】

我需要一些帮助,因为我有点迷茫. 假设我有一个数据框的列,我需要用前几行的某些元素填充.为简化起见,我制作了一个pd.series:lista = ['hola','salut','hello','xixie'] index1 = (0, 23,77,88) lista2 = pd.Series(lista, index = index1)我需要做的是用列表中的元素填充lista2的索引之间的间隙,所以我需要从0行到22’hola’,从22行到76’salut’,依此类推.该系列的总长度必须为88. 希望大家都能理解我,并预先感谢!解决方法:尝试...

使用python的JavaScript查询生成的刮取元素【代码】

我正在尝试访问内容由javascript生成的元素中的文本.例如,从this site获取Twitter份额数. 我尝试使用urllib和pyqt获取页面的html,但是由于内容需要生成javascript,因此urllib / pyqt的响应中不存在其HTML.我目前正在使用硒来完成这项任务,但是它花费的时间比我想要的要长. 是否可以访问此数据而无需在浏览器中打开页面? 过去已经有人问过这个问题,但是我发现的结果是c# specific或提供了指向自gone dead以来的解决方案的链接解决方...

python-根据相邻元素选择【代码】

说我有一些numpy的数组myArr.我知道我可以轻松选择myArr> x以查找值大于x的元素的索引. 我如何找到相邻元素在x上方的元素索引?对于一维数组,与某些idx相邻的元素是(idx-1,idx 1).对于d维数组,我的意思是任意维中的邻居.即,令d = 3. myArr [2,2,2]的邻居是[(1,2,2),(2,1,2),(2,2,1),(3,2,2),(2,3, 2),(2,2,3)]. 例如拿import numpy as np test = np.arange(4**2).reshape((4,4))在这里,我们可以从图形上看到5的相邻元素为[1、4、6...

python如何实现元素等待【代码】

一、为什么要元素等待?在UI自动化过程中,元素的出现受网络环境、设备性能等多种元素影响。因此,元素加载和脚本运行到该元素的时间不一致,会报错:元素无法定位。简单举下例子:实际UI自动化测试中,点击一个登录控件需要启动一个新activity界面,或需要加载弹框,或请求网络加载数据成功后刷新页面,此时需要等待一段时间,新界面出现了才能继续执行UI操作,否则数据还在加载ing,脚本已开始执行新界面操作的代码,脚本就会报错...

在Python 3.6中添加迭代时重复元素【代码】

我正在尝试编写一部分代码,该代码从两个不同的列表中获取元素并进行匹配,如下所示,但是由于某种原因,我一直在输出列表中重复获取元素.def assign_tasks(operators, requests, current_time):"""Assign operators to pending requests.Requires:- operators, a collection of operators, structured as the output of filesReading.read_operators_file;- requests, a list of requests, structured as the output of filesReading....

python-获取矩阵的相邻元素的总和【代码】

我有一个矩阵例如.[[4,5,0,0,0],[5,1,2,1,0],[0,2,3,2,0],[0,1,2,1,0],[0,0,0,0,0]]对于矩阵中的每个元素,我试图获取其相邻对角元素的总和及其相邻水平和垂直元素的总和. 以矩阵中间的3为例,我试图计算对角相邻元素(1)与水平和垂直相邻元素(2)的总和.对于拐角和边缘情况,我想忽略没有元素的区域,例如(对于左上角的4,我想获得对角线相邻的1的总和以及水平和垂直相邻的总和5的. 在python中最有效的方法是什么? 到目前为止,我已经提出...

【Appium + Python3】之安卓8.1,使用xpath定位不到元素【代码】

desired_cap = {"deviceName":"vivo", # 真机名称"platformName":"android", # 使用的移动端:android、ios"platformVersion":"8.1",  # 移动端版本"appPackage":"com.csksc2b.invertory", # 被测试软件Package名"appActivity":"com.csks.login.SplashAty", # 被测试软件Activity名"noReset":True, # 重置应用状态:True,不重置,...

修改Python列表中的一个元素时出错【代码】

这个问题已经在这里有了答案: > List of lists changes reflected across sublists unexpectedly 12个> Generating sublists using multiplication ( * ) unexpected behavior 5个我正在尝试更改Python列表中的元素.遵循有关https://www.programiz.com/python-programming/matrix的教程之后,我想到了下面的代码.matrix...

元素 - 相关标签